Stories From the Studio: Melissa Garside

Melissa is the author of the delightful Lexie Moon junior fiction series, with the first two books already capturing young readers’ imaginations. And now, something very exciting is on the horizon…

Melissa has always had a love affair with words, the kind that starts early and simply never lets go. As a child, she was already spinning tales writing her very first masterpiece in kindergarten featuring a pirate named Jim. These days, Melissa brings that lifelong love of storytelling together with a deep, intuitive understanding of what kids truly enjoy reading, something she’s honed over years in the classroom as a teacher.

Melissa lives in beautiful Wollondilly with her lively crew: her family, a hilariously lovable golden retriever who keeps everyone on their toes, and a flock of free-ranging chooks who provide equal parts entertainment and chaos. When she’s not writing or teaching, you’ll likely find her out in the garden, happily digging in the dirt, soaking up nature, or experimenting in the kitchen, usually without a recipe and often with her family bravely acting as taste-testers! 

As a kid, Melissa filled her days with stories, handmade family newspapers, and plays for friends, and she’s never really stopped. While she’s always written for fun, she began seriously writing for children in 2018, drawing inspiration from the books she adored growing up, classics like The Wind in the Willows, Alice’s Adventures in Wonderland, Roald Dahl’s wildly imaginative stories, and the beloved Anne of Green Gables series. Anything that sparked her imagination found a place in her heart and now, in her writing.

Her ideas can come from anywhere: a curious observation, a fleeting “what if?” moment, or simply letting her mind wander. She’s a big believer in daydreaming and never goes far without a notebook, ready to capture ideas before they disappear.

Lexie Moon and the Remote Control Catastrophe
Launching 16th June 2026

Get ready for laughs, gadgets, chaos—and one seriously clever kid inventor!
In this highly anticipated third instalment, Lexie Moon has built a scrap-box remote-control car she hopes will win second prize in the local competition—a Mega-Boost signal amplifier she desperately wants. But when her transmitter and the prize disappear, Lexie discovers they’ve been stolen by Connie van Quish, sister of her archenemy – the infamous Gizmo Lightfinger. Connie has combined them into a powerful UniMote, a device capable of controlling any remotely operated machine. With gadgets across town spiralling into chaos, Lexie and Grandad race to track down the UniMote, stop Connie’s schemes and restore order. Along the way, Lexie discovers that teamwork, family—and even little sisters—can make all the difference.
A fast, funny STEM-themed adventure filled with invention, problem-solving and remote-control mayhem.
